What is a PVC Matt Sheet?

In simple terms, a pvc matt sheet is a flat, rigid sheet made of polyvinyl chloride, finished with a matte surface texture that reduces gloss and reflection. This matte finish isn’t just aesthetic—it minimizes glare in applications like signage and interiors, helping reduce eye strain and enhancing visual appeal.

In the context of modern industry, these sheets are prized for a combination of physical durability, chemical resistance, and ease of fabrication. Plus, they’re lightweight compared to metals or glass alternatives, making them easier and cheaper to transport and install. From humanitarian aid shelters to automotive interiors, their adaptability helps meet both practical and ethical needs.

Key Features of PVC Matt Sheets

Durability and Chemical Resistance

One of the biggest draws is their resilience. PVC matt sheets resist many acids, alkalis, and salts. This is why they are often used in chemical plants or outdoor applications—expecting harsh environments but requiring a steady material to hold up.

Ease of Fabrication

They can be cut, drilled, and thermoformed, which means manufacturers and fabricators can customize shapes and sizes efficiently, without heavy equipment or expensive processes.

Cost Efficiency

Compared to other sheets like polycarbonate or metal, PVC matt sheet pricing is highly competitive, making them attractive choices for large-scale projects where budget constraints exist.

Weather and UV Resistance

While standard PVC can degrade under UV rays, many matt sheets have additives (UV stabilizers) to prolong outdoor life, which is critical in signage and outdoor cladding.

Fire Retardancy

Many PVC matt sheets come with inherently good fire retardant properties, which is a bonus in safety-critical areas like schools and hospitals.

Environmental Considerations

Modern manufacturers increasingly focus on producing recyclable, low-VOC (volatile organic compounds) PVC matt sheets to lessen environmental impact.

Typical PVC Matt Sheet Specifications
Property Value Unit
Thickness Range 1-10 mm
Density 1.3 - 1.5 g/cm³
Tensile Strength 40 - 50 MPa
Operating Temperature -15 to 60 °C
UV Stabilized Yes (optional) -

Global Applications and Use Cases

The reach of PVC matt sheets is surprisingly wide:

  • Construction: Used as wall panels, roofs, ceiling tiles, and partition walls in commercial and residential buildings worldwide.
  • Signage: Their matte finish enhances readability in street signs, billboards, and exhibition panels.
  • Transportation: Interiors of buses, trains, and even ships rely on these sheets for their balance of weight and durability.
  • Industrial: Linings for chemical tanks or protective covers, especially in industrial zones in China, Germany, and the US.
  • Humanitarian aid: Temporary shelters after natural disasters often utilize PVC matt sheets because of ease of transport and installation.

Oddly enough, remote mining operations in Australia use PVC matt-sheet cladding to protect equipment from harsh weather while keeping costs manageable.

Future Trends and Innovations

Looking ahead, the industry is pushing boundaries:

  • Bio-based additives: To reduce fossil fuel reliance, manufacturers are exploring bio-derived plasticizers and stabilizers.
  • Enhanced recyclability: Closed-loop systems aim to repurpose production scrap, improving circular economy metrics.
  • Smart coatings: Incorporating antimicrobial or self-cleaning finishes to broaden applications.
  • Digital fabrication: Integration with CNC machining and 3D printing to create more complex shapes.

In real terms, this means pvc matt sheets won't just be static material blocks but components in smarter building systems or modular construction kits.

Challenges and Solutions

Every product has its downsides, and PVC matt sheets are no exception:

  • Environmental concerns: The chlorine content in PVC and reliance on plasticizers can cause pollution if not managed.
  • UV degradation: Even UV-stabilized sheets need proper maintenance and replacement schedules outdoors.
  • End-of-life disposal: Without proper recycling infrastructures, sheets may contribute to plastic waste.

Experts recommend purchasing from vendors that ensure certification (like ISO 14001 for environmental management) and providing take-back programs or recyclability guarantees. Innovative recycling methods like chemical recycling might become mainstream soon.

Frequently Asked Questions About PVC Matt Sheet

Q: What are the typical thickness options available for PVC matt sheets?

A: PVC matt sheets commonly come in thicknesses ranging from 1mm to 10mm, depending on usage. Thinner sheets are ideal for signage or light partitions, while thicker sheets suit structural applications. Custom thicknesses can often be ordered for specific projects.

Q: How weather-resistant are PVC matt sheets for outdoor installations?

A: With UV stabilizers added during production, these sheets can withstand prolonged exposure to sunlight and rain. However, long-term exposure may require periodic inspection and replacement as part of maintenance.

Q: Are PVC matt sheets recyclable?

A: Yes, PVC matt sheets are recyclable, but the availability of recycling facilities varies globally. Many suppliers now offer take-back or recycling programs to ensure responsible end-of-life management.

Q: Can PVC matt sheets be used in healthcare environments?

A: Certainly. Their chemical resistance and ease of cleaning make them suitable for hospital partitions and surfaces. Plus, fire retardancy is a big safety advantage in these settings.

Q: How do PVC matt sheets compare cost-wise to alternatives like polycarbonate or aluminum?

A: PVC matt sheets are generally more affordable and lighter but with slightly lower impact resistance than polycarbonate. Compared to aluminum, they are less expensive and easier to fabricate, but not as strong structurally.
